Sleek and Modern Design

Embrace sleek and modern design elements to create a sophisticated ambiance in your half bathroom. Opt for clean lines, minimalist fixtures, and a neutral color palette to achieve a contemporary look that exudes elegance. Consider installing a floating vanity to maximize space and enhance the sense of openness in the room.

Bold Statement Pieces

Make a statement in your half bathroom with bold and eye-catching decor pieces that command attention. Choose a vibrant wallpaper or geometric tile pattern to add visual interest to the space. Incorporate unique accessories such as brass fixtures, decorative mirrors, or sculptural lighting fixtures to inject personality and character into the room.

Cozy and Inviting Atmosphere

Transform your half bathroom into a cozy and inviting retreat by incorporating warm and welcoming decor elements. Soft textiles such as plush towels, a cozy rug, and a fabric shower curtain can instantly create a sense of comfort and coziness. Add touches of natural materials like wood or bamboo for a touch of warmth and texture.

Maximize Storage Solutions

Optimize storage in your half bathroom with clever organizational solutions that are both functional and stylish. Consider installing shelves or cabinets above the toilet to store toiletries, towels, and other essentials. Utilize baskets or decorative bins to corral smaller items and keep the space clutter-free. Incorporate multi-functional furniture pieces like a vanity with built-in storage or a ladder shelf for added versatility.

Play with Patterns and Textures

Add visual interest to your half bathroom with the use of patterns and textures that complement your decor style. Experiment with a mix of materials such as marble, ceramic, and glass to create depth and dimension in the space. Incorporate patterned wallpaper, textured tiles, or decorative accents like woven baskets or embroidered towels to add personality and charm.

Incorporate Natural Elements

Bring the beauty of the outdoors into your half bathroom by incorporating natural elements that evoke a sense of serenity and relaxation. Consider adding potted plants or a small vase of fresh flowers to infuse the space with greenery and vitality. Incorporate natural materials like stone, wood, or bamboo for a touch of organic elegance.

Enhance Lighting Design

Illuminate your half bathroom with thoughtful lighting design that enhances the ambiance and functionality of the space. Incorporate a mix of task lighting, ambient lighting, and accent lighting to create layers of light that cater to different needs and moods. Install a statement fixture like a pendant light or chandelier to add drama and style to the room.

Streamlined Serenity Minimalist Living Room Design

Crafting Your Streamlined Serenity: Minimalist Living Room Design

Embracing Minimalist Principles

In a world filled with distractions and clutter, creating a minimalist living room design offers a sanctuary of calm and serenity. Embracing minimalist principles means stripping away the unnecessary to reveal the essential, allowing for a space that fosters clarity and peace of mind. By paring down to the essentials and focusing on quality over quantity, you can transform your living room into a streamlined oasis of serenity.

Clean Lines and Open Spaces

At the heart of minimalist living room design are clean lines and open spaces. This aesthetic choice creates an atmosphere of tranquility and order, free from visual clutter and unnecessary distractions. Choose furniture with simple, sleek silhouettes and opt for a neutral color palette to enhance the sense of openness. By eliminating excess ornamentation and embracing simplicity, you can achieve a living room that feels both modern and serene.

Decluttering Your Space

Decluttering is a fundamental aspect of minimalist living room design. Take the time to assess your space and remove any items that are not essential or do not bring you joy. Keep surfaces clear of unnecessary knick-knacks and opt for storage solutions that allow for easy organization and tidiness. By clearing out the clutter, you create a sense of spaciousness and calm that promotes relaxation and well-being.

Quality Over Quantity

In minimalist design, less is more, and this principle applies to the selection of furniture and décor items as well. Instead of filling your living room with an abundance of furnishings, opt for a few high-quality pieces that serve both a functional and aesthetic purpose. Invest in timeless pieces that will stand the test of time and resist the urge to overcrowd your space with unnecessary items. By prioritizing quality over quantity, you can create a living room that exudes sophistication and elegance.

Natural Light and Airiness

Maximizing natural light is key to achieving a sense of airiness and openness in your minimalist living room design. Remove heavy window treatments and allow sunlight to flood into the space, creating a warm and inviting atmosphere. Position furniture to take advantage of natural light and use mirrors strategically to reflect and amplify it throughout the room. By embracing natural light, you can enhance the sense of serenity and spaciousness in your living room.

Monochrome Palette with Accent Details

A monochrome color palette serves as the foundation of minimalist living room design, with white, gray, and beige being popular choices. These neutral hues create a sense of harmony and cohesion, allowing furniture and décor items to stand out without overwhelming the space. Add visual interest and depth to your living room by incorporating accent details in a complementary color or texture. Whether it’s a pop of color through a throw pillow or a textured rug, these accent details add personality and warmth to your minimalist space.

Budget-Friendly Minimalist Living Room Makeover Ideas

Transforming Your Living Space: Budget-Friendly Minimalist Makeover Ideas

Maximizing Space Efficiency

When embarking on a minimalist living room makeover, the first step is to maximize space efficiency. Evaluate the layout of your room and consider multifunctional furniture pieces that serve multiple purposes. Opt for sleek, streamlined designs that minimize visual clutter and create a sense of openness. By strategically arranging furniture and incorporating storage solutions such as ottomans with hidden compartments or wall-mounted shelves, you can make the most of every square foot without breaking the bank.

Decluttering and Simplifying

Central to minimalist design is the principle of decluttering and simplifying. Take a critical look at your current décor and furnishings, and ruthlessly edit out anything that doesn’t serve a purpose or bring you joy. Consider adopting a “less is more” approach by focusing on a few key pieces that make a statement rather than filling the room with unnecessary items. Clearing surfaces and minimizing knick-knacks not only creates a cleaner aesthetic but also promotes a sense of calm and tranquility in your living space.

Neutral Color Palette

A budget-friendly way to refresh your living room aesthetic is by updating the color palette. Opting for a neutral color scheme, such as whites, grays, and earth tones, can instantly create a more cohesive and timeless look. Neutral hues provide a versatile backdrop that allows you to easily switch out accent pieces and accessories without having to overhaul your entire décor. Consider adding pops of color through textiles, such as throw pillows or area rugs, to inject personality and warmth into the space while maintaining a minimalist vibe.

Embracing Natural Light

Harnessing natural light is another budget-friendly way to enhance your living room makeover. Maximize the amount of natural light streaming into the room by keeping window treatments minimal or opting for sheer curtains that allow sunlight to filter through. Positioning mirrors strategically can also help bounce light around the space, making it feel larger and more inviting. Embracing natural light not only brightens up your living room but also creates a welcoming atmosphere that promotes relaxation and well-being.

Incorporating Greenery

Bringing the outdoors in is a cost-effective way to breathe life into your minimalist living room makeover. Incorporating houseplants or fresh flowers adds a touch of natural beauty and vitality to the space while improving air quality and promoting a sense of well-being. Opt for low-maintenance plants such as succulents or pothos that thrive in indoor environments and require minimal care. Place them strategically throughout the room to create visual interest and infuse your living space with a sense of serenity and harmony.

DIY Décor and Upcycling

Get creative with DIY décor projects and upcycling to add personality and character to your minimalist living room makeover without breaking the bank. Consider repurposing old furniture or accessories with a fresh coat of paint or reupholstering them with budget-friendly fabrics to give them new life.
